Why this role matters
Business Intelligence Analyst turns data into clear, actionable insights and scalable analytical solutions. The role combines dashboard development, reporting automation, semantic-layer thinking, and close collaboration with stakeholders to support accurate, timely decision-making. This role focuses on creating accurate, neat and clear visualizations of corporate data, supported by observations and conclusions.

What you'll actually do
Collaborate with stakeholders to gather business requirements and translate them into analytical solutions and reporting needs
Define, standardize, and maintain key business metrics and KPIs, ensuring alignment across teams
Identify gaps, inefficiencies, and opportunities through data analysis and propose actionable solutions
Drive adoption of data-driven decision-making by aligning insights with business goals and priorities
Collect, clean, and analyze data from multiple sources to generate reliable and actionable insights
Build, test, and maintain scalable data models and datasets for reporting and self-service analytics
Ensure data quality, consistency, and governance across all analytical outputs and data sources
Develop and validate hypotheses, monitor KPIs, and proactively identify trends, risks, and opportunities
Collaborate with Data Engineering to improve data pipelines, availability, and performance
Design, develop, and maintain intuitive and scalable dashboards (Tableau or similar BI tools)
Translate complex data into clear, structured, and visually compelling insights for diverse audiences
Ensure consistency and usability of reports by following visualization best practices and standards
Automate and optimize reporting processes to improve efficiency and scalability
Support business users with reporting tools, ensuring accessibility and correct interpretation of data
Who We’re Looking For
Bachelor’s or Master’s degree preferably in Mathematical / Software Engineering / Computer Science education. Relevant certifications optional but beneficial: Tableau Certified Data Analyst, Tableau Certified Architect
5+ years of experience in BI (data analysis and visualization, reporting automation) with proven practical experience in full-cycle dashboards development
Strong SQL skills and hands-on experience with analytical databases (Vertica, ClickHouse, Trino, Starrocks or similar)
Strong data visualization skills, including proficiency in Tableau Desktop (or other enterprise level BI tool)
Strong understanding of dimensional modeling, metric governance, and self-service analytics principles
Understanding of AI/LLM applications in analytics (e.g., NL-to-SQL, AI-assisted BI)
Solid knowledge of data analysis methods and basic statistics
Effective stakeholder management skills, especially in cross-functional setups (to understand the needs of stakeholders and manage their expectations, as well as effectively communicate findings and stages of the development cycle in common)
Excellent problem-solving skills and the ability to make reasonable technical decisions on fundamental data analysis methods and data visualization
Strong ownership mindset with the ability to be an expert in the relevant data domain
Excellent English communication skills
